1. Top Job Opportunities for Freshers in 2025
Freshers in 2025 The tech industry offers exciting career paths for fresh graduates, with Software Engineering roles being the most sought-after. As a Software Engineer, you’ll need proficiency in Python, Java, or C++, along with strong knowledge of Data Structures & Algorithms and web development fundamentals (HTML, CSS, JavaScript). Major employers like TCS, Infosys, and Wipro offer work-from-home opportunities, while Accenture and Capgemini conduct regular walk-in interviews.
Freshers in 2025 For analytically-minded graduates, Data Scientist positions at IBM, Amazon, and Flipkart (WFH options) or Cognizant and Deloitte (walk-in opportunities) require Python/R programming skills, machine learning expertise, and data visualization capabilities using tools like Tableau and Power BI. Cloud Engineering roles are equally promising, demanding AWS/Azure/GCP certifications along with Linux and networking knowledge, with Google Cloud and Microsoft Azure leading in remote positions while HCL and Tech Mahindra offer in-person opportunities.
Freshers in 2025 The DevOps field presents excellent prospects, where skills in Docker, Kubernetes, Jenkins, and scripting languages (Bash, Python) are essential. IBM and Cisco hire for remote DevOps positions, while Mindtree and L&T Infotech conduct campus recruitments. Linux Administration roles at Red Hat and Dell (WFH) or Wipro and TCS (walk-in) require expertise in Linux OS, shell scripting, and server management.
Freshers in 2025 Cybersecurity positions are growing exponentially, with Palo Alto and Symantec offering remote roles and Infosys/Tech Mahindra conducting on-site interviews – these require ethical hacking skills, network security knowledge, and certifications like CEH or CISSP. Finally, AI Engineering roles at NVIDIA and OpenAI (remote) or Accenture and Capgemini (in-person) demand expertise in deep learning, NLP frameworks like TensorFlow/PyTorch, and AI model deployment techniques.
